Yes, we work directly with all major insurance providers. We document the entire water extraction and drying process, capture thermal moisture logs, and submit claims directly to minimize your out-of-pocket costs and stress.
If the water is from a clean source (like a supply line) and addressed quickly, we can often extract the water and dry the carpet and pad. If it is grey or black water, the carpet must be removed for safety.
Typically, it takes 3 to 5 days to completely dry structural materials like drywall and framing, but this depends heavily on the extent of saturation and materials involved.
